Thangs 2 – If you can dodge the Bacon, You Can dodge a ball

Team freeze dodgeball/ capture the flag

The “Bacon” is placed at center court, each team is located at their respective endline. Balss are spread everywhere.

On my go, teams advance to steal the bacon and return it to their base line. However if the person with the bacon is hit with a ball they must freeze and can not throw the ball.

Others, from either team can advance to take the bacon and attempt to return it to base.

Frozen player can be unfrozen by someone crawling through their legs

— I think we palyed 3 or 4 rounds of this

After further review the COT I put in Friday was actually Saturday… I have no idea what I said Friday so here is Saturday’s again.

 

I was thinking yesterday about attending the funeral of a friend a few years ago. This was the house that everyone hung out at in out neighborhood. His mom was our mom, and I literally spent more time there than at my home during the summers.

When I went through the receiving line to give my condolences Mrs. T said, we still have our”Luke Bush” it just and big as can be. I had to think for a minute before I remembered what she was talking about. Many years back we were hanging around the house one Saturday while Mr. and Mrs. T where doing yardwork and I jumped in to help. We dug a hole and planted a bush. Not a big deal, at least to me. That tree become know as the Luke Tree (btw my name is Luke) because of the small but selfless act i did to help them. It is amazing how the smallest things can mean soo much to others.

I often get this in coaching. I will have a kid come up to me and say “I did what you said coach”, only to have no idea what he is talking about. I had made some offhand comment about how Little Johnny should work on something and he went home and worked all week on it.

This reminds me of a saying I have taped up above my desk ( i always get it wrong) Let my actions and and my words match my heart.

When you go out there today think about how your words and your actions will affect those around you. Do your best to be the man you want to be, the man you strive to be at all times.
